Nuestra descripción del puesto de incluye responsabilidades, deberes, habilidades, educación, calificaciones y experiencia.
Acerca del rol de
El Desarrollador C++ es responsable de diseñar y desarrollar aplicaciones de software utilizando el lenguaje C++. Deben tener habilidades sólidas para resolver problemas, ser capaces de analizar sistemas complejos y trabajar de forma independiente y colaborativa. Deben tener un buen entendimiento de los conceptos de programación orientada a objetos y experiencia con depuración y ajuste de rendimiento. Además, deben tener habilidades de comunicación excelentes, tanto escritas como verbales, para comunicarse efectivamente con compañeros, gerencia y otras partes interesadas.
Propósito del Rol
El propósito de un rol de trabajo de Desarrollador C++ es diseñar, desarrollar, probar, implementar, mantener y mejorar software escrito en el lenguaje de programación C++. Esto incluye escribir código, depurar y crear componentes del sistema de software, así como proporcionar orientación técnica y apoyo a otros desarrolladores. El Desarrollador C++ debe ser capaz de evaluar las necesidades del cliente y diseñar y desarrollar soluciones de software que cumplan con esas necesidades. Deben ser capaces de asumir la responsabilidad de sus proyectos y sentirse cómodos trabajando de forma independiente o en equipo.
Resumen de
Esta posición de Desarrollador C++ es responsable de diseñar y desarrollar sistemas de software utilizando lenguajes de programación C++. El candidato ideal tendrá experiencia trabajando con programación orientada a objetos y desarrollando software para múltiples plataformas. El candidato también debe tener una comprensión sólida de estructuras de datos, algoritmos y técnicas de depuración. El Desarrollador C++ será responsable de escribir, probar y solucionar problemas de código, así como de participar en revisiones de código. La capacidad de trabajar colaborativamente con compañeros y otros departamentos también es esencial. El candidato exitoso podrá trabajar de forma independiente y cumplir con los plazos.
Deberes de
- Diseñar, desarrollar y mantener aplicaciones de software utilizando C++
- Crear código mantenible para el desarrollo continuo del producto
- Colaborar con otros desarrolladores de software y partes interesadas
- Depurar y optimizar aplicaciones existentes
- Desarrollar documentación técnica
- Mantenerse actualizado con las nuevas tendencias tecnológicas
Habilidades de
- Programación C++
- Diseño Orientado a Objetos
- Diseño y Arquitectura de Software
- Depuración y Resolución de Problemas
- Resolución de Problemas Algorítmicos
Requisitos de
- Competencia en el lenguaje de programación C++
- Experiencia con programación orientada a objetos
- Familiaridad con herramientas de desarrollo como Visual Studio
- Conocimiento de prácticas recomendadas de ingeniería de software
Rasgos Personales
- Habilidades para resolver problemas
- Pensamiento analítico
- Atención a los detalles
- Habilidades de comunicación sólidas
- Trabajo en equipo
- Capacidad para trabajar de forma independiente